Cosè il sé in Python: esempi del mondo reale
Cos'è il sé in Python: esempi del mondo reale
L'unione è un'altra potente trasformazione per ottimizzare le nostre tabelle e le informazioni che potremmo ottenere da varie fonti. Imparare a unire le query in LuckyTemplates è importante in quanto questa trasformazione può semplificare i nostri modelli di dati.
Ottenere dati da fonti diverse in LuckyTemplates non è un grosso problema. Non importa davvero da dove provengano i dati poiché diventeranno solo una query. Ciò che conta davvero è come strutturiamo quelle tabelle nel nostro modello.
Detto questo, la fusione è un'ottima tecnica per creare tabelle totalmente diverse da quelle che abbiamo normalmente poiché possiamo combinare molte tabelle. In questo articolo imparerai come unire le query in LuckyTemplates in modo efficace.
Sommario
Opzione Unisci query in LuckyTemplates
Ad esempio, la tabella Channel Details può essere una tabella di ricerca logica che possiamo inserire nel nostro modello di dati. Ma dobbiamo lasciarla come query di staging perché possiamo ancora utilizzarla unendola fisicamente alla nostra tabella Sales .
Per farlo, selezioniamo la tabella Vendite , quindi facciamo clic sull'opzione Unisci query all'interno della barra multifunzione Home .
La tabella dei dettagli del canale dirama sempre tutte le dimensioni in base al canale. Quindi, selezioniamo ed evidenziamo la colonna Canale .
Quindi, cerchiamo e selezioniamo la tabella Dettagli canale qui.
Questo ci darà un'anteprima. Vedremo che la colonna Channel Name suddivide Export , Distributor e Wholesale , che sono i tre tipi di elementi all'interno della nostra tabella dei fatti ( tabella Sales ). Selezioniamo la colonna Nome canale .
Unisci le query in LuckyTemplates tramite le opzioni Join Kind
Ci sono diverse opzioni di Join Kind che possiamo usare. Consiglio vivamente di esplorare le opzioni che puoi utilizzare. Non esamineremo tutte le opzioni perché possiamo semplicemente usare l' opzione Left Outer .
Tuttavia, ci sono rari casi in cui potremmo aver bisogno di utilizzare le altre opzioni di Join Kind . Dobbiamo solo testarli e se non otteniamo il risultato giusto, dobbiamo provare le altre opzioni di Join Kind .
In questo esempio, uniremo tutto dalla nostra colonna Channel , che si trova nella tabella Sales , al lato sinistro della colonna Channel Name dalla tabella Channel Details o dalla query.
Seleziona l' opzione Left Outer e ci darà un'anteprima di seguito affermando che c'è una corrispondenza totale. Successivamente, fai clic sul pulsante OK .
Ora, sono successe alcune cose nella nostra tabella delle vendite . La prima cosa che noteremo è che abbiamo una trasformazione aggiunta all'interno dei nostri APPLIED STEPS , che indica che abbiamo Merged Query .
Tuttavia, non ci ha fornito tutte le colonne aggiuntive della tabella Dettagli canale . In questo caso, dobbiamo fare clic sulle doppie frecce accanto al nome della colonna Dettagli canale .
Vedremo quindi tutte le diverse opzioni disponibili, che sono le colonne della tabella Dettagli canale . Ad esempio, stiamo unendo le tabelle e ci sono molte colonne che non volevamo unire. Tutto quello che dobbiamo fare è selezionare solo le colonne che vogliamo inserire. Prima lasciamole tutte selezionate e facciamo clic sul pulsante OK .
Vedremo che tutte le colonne di quella tabella di supporto sono ora apparse su ogni singola riga all'interno della nostra tabella dei fatti.
Applicazione di trasformazioni aggiuntive
Inoltre, possiamo semplicemente rimuovere questa colonna Canale qui perché abbiamo già una colonna simile che è stata aggiunta utilizzando la tecnica di unione che abbiamo fatto in precedenza.
Quindi, rinominiamo le colonne appena aggiunte nella nostra tabella in Channel , Short Code , Alt. Nome , importanza e codice precedente .
Queste sono tutte dimensioni diverse che ora possiamo usare sui nostri modelli e visualizzazioni. Siamo in grado di creare facilmente questa query dettagliata che alla fine diventerà una tabella.
Ora, se controlliamo la nostra sezione PASSI APPLICATI , tutte le cose che abbiamo fatto sono state aggiunte automaticamente. Abbiamo aggiunto query, colonne unite, espanse, rimosse e rinominate.
Se controlliamo il nostro Editor avanzato , il codice M indica esattamente la stessa cosa dalla nostra sezione PASSI APPLICATI . Queste sono le trasformazioni che abbiamo fatto in precedenza.
Conclusione
In definitiva, l'unione delle query è un'altra potente trasformazione che ottimizza le nostre query e tabelle per i modelli di dati. È importante capire come li useremo e riunirli tutti insieme. Questo ci consentirà di creare queste query e tabelle completamente ottimizzate. Possiamo quindi utilizzarli all'interno del nostro modello di dati per rendere i nostri calcoli DAX più efficaci.
In effetti, la trasformazione delle query di unione è un'aggiunta indispensabile al nostro pensiero analitico e allo sviluppo del modello in LuckyTemplates.
Cos'è il sé in Python: esempi del mondo reale
Imparerai come salvare e caricare oggetti da un file .rds in R. Questo blog tratterà anche come importare oggetti da R a LuckyTemplates.
In questa esercitazione sul linguaggio di codifica DAX, scopri come usare la funzione GENERATE e come modificare dinamicamente il titolo di una misura.
Questo tutorial illustrerà come utilizzare la tecnica di visualizzazione dinamica multi-thread per creare approfondimenti dalle visualizzazioni di dati dinamici nei report.
In questo articolo, esaminerò il contesto del filtro. Il contesto del filtro è uno degli argomenti principali che qualsiasi utente di LuckyTemplates dovrebbe inizialmente conoscere.
Voglio mostrare come il servizio online di LuckyTemplates Apps può aiutare nella gestione di diversi report e approfondimenti generati da varie fonti.
Scopri come elaborare le modifiche al margine di profitto utilizzando tecniche come la ramificazione delle misure e la combinazione di formule DAX in LuckyTemplates.
Questo tutorial discuterà delle idee di materializzazione delle cache di dati e di come influiscono sulle prestazioni dei DAX nel fornire risultati.
Se finora utilizzi ancora Excel, questo è il momento migliore per iniziare a utilizzare LuckyTemplates per le tue esigenze di reportistica aziendale.
Che cos'è il gateway LuckyTemplates? Tutto quello che devi sapere